Shanghai Electric Achieves Top Five Position in Global Desalination Project Ranking

Shanghai Electric Ranks Amongst the Best in Global Desalination Projects



Shanghai Electric has made headlines by securing the fifth spot in the global ranking for newly implemented desalination projects for the years 2024-2025. This significant achievement not only marks a four-position leap from the previous ranking but also highlights Shanghai Electric's commitment to innovation and sustainable practices in water treatment.

The ranking is based on recently published statistics by the International Desalination and Reuse Association (IDRA) and Global Water Intelligence (GWI), which provide market analysis in the water sector. Shanghai Electric's cumulative performance over the last decade (2016-2025) also reflects positively, placing them at eighth worldwide. This progression is attributed to strong international support for their expertise in desalination and project execution.

Technological Expertise Behind the Rankings



According to Shanghai Electric, this notable rise in rankings illustrates their extensive development in both thermal and membrane technologies over the past decade. The organization emphasizes their continual commitment to providing environmentally friendly and efficient desalination solutions to address global water shortages.

Shanghai Electric stands out as one of the few global firms adept in two primary desalination technologies: Multi-Effect Distillation (MED) and Reverse Osmosis (RO). By integrating both technologies, they offer comprehensive solutions tailored to diverse industrial needs. These solutions emphasize energy conservation while ensuring a steady supply of high-quality freshwater critical for industries such as energy, metallurgy, and chemical production.

Over the years, Shanghai Electric has gained widespread recognition for its technological reliability, project execution capabilities, and international brand presence. Their rise in the rankings is closely linked to their robust technological solutions covering the entire desalination spectrum, as well as their proven record of successful large-scale project deliveries both domestically and abroad.

Benchmark Projects of Distinction



Among their key projects, the Hengyi PMB petrochemical project in Brunei has emerged as a reference model, featuring a remarkable capacity of 3×12,500 tons per day. This project employs the innovative Low Temperature Multi-Effect Distillation (LT-MED) technology combined with rapid evaporation, showcasing Shanghai Electric's engineering capabilities. Moreover, the Zhejiang Petroleum Chemical Co., Ltd. wastewater heat desalination project stands out as the largest thermal desalination EPC project in China, with a formidable capacity of 305,000 tons per day across its two phases, utilizing Forward Multi-Effect Distillation (F-MED) technology.

The Yulong Petrochemical hybrid desalination project in Yantai, boasting a capacity of 160,000 tons per day, exemplifies the advanced hybrid F-MED-RO technology. By adopting a cascading utilization approach for recovering low-temperature industrial waste heat, this project sets the precedent for a low-emission, resource-efficient water production method. It is recognized as the world's largest hybrid seawater desalination project utilizing both thermal and membrane technology.
